只为小站
首页
域名查询
文件下载
登录
EDA/PLD中的用FPGA产生高斯白噪声序列的一种快速方法
0 引言 短波信道存在多径时延、多普勒频移和扩散、高斯白噪声干扰等复杂现象。为了测试短波通信设备的性能,通常需要进行大量的外场实验。相比之下,信道模拟器能够在实验室环境下进行类似的性能测试,而且测试费用少、可重复性强,可以缩短设备的研制周期。所以自行研制信道模拟器十分必要。 信道模拟器可选用比较有代表性的 Watterson 信道模型 ( 即高斯散射增益抽头延迟线模型 ) ,其中一个重要环节就是快速产生高斯白噪声序列,便于在添加多普勒扩展和高斯白噪声影响时使用。传统的高斯白噪声发生器是在微处理器和 DSP 软件系统上实现的,其仿真速度比硬件仿真器慢的多。因此,选取 FPGA 硬件平 在电子设计自动化(EDA)和可编程逻辑器件(PLD)领域,利用FPGA(现场可编程门阵列)产生高斯白噪声序列是一种高效的方法,尤其在构建信道模拟器时至关重要。信道模拟器用于模拟真实环境下的通信信道特征,例如短波通信信道,这些信道常常受到多径时延、多普勒频移和高斯白噪声的干扰。通过模拟这些现象,可以对通信设备进行性能测试,节省大量外场实验的成本,并增强测试的可重复性。 Watterson信道模型是一种广泛应用的信道模拟模型,它基于高斯散射增益抽头延迟线,其中需要快速生成高斯白噪声序列。传统方法是在微处理器或数字信号处理器(DSP)上实现,这种方法在速度上远不及硬件仿真。FPGA硬件平台则提供了更快速、全数字化处理的解决方案,具有更低的测试成本、更高的可重复性和实时性。 本文介绍了一种基于FPGA的高斯白噪声序列快速生成技术。该技术利用均匀分布与高斯分布之间的映射关系,采用折线逼近法在FPGA中实现。这种方法简便、快速且硬件资源占用少,使用VHDL语言编写,具备良好的可移植性和灵活性,可以方便地集成到调制解调器中。 生成均匀分布的随机数是关键步骤。m序列发生器是一种常用的伪随机数生成器,由线性反馈移位寄存器(LFSR)产生,其特点是周期长、统计特性接近随机。m序列的周期与LFSR的级数有关,例如,采用18级LFSR,对应的本原多项式为x18+x7+1,可以生成(2^18-1)长度的序列。然而,由于LFSR的工作机制,相邻的序列状态并非完全独立,因此需要降低相关性。 降低相关性可以通过每隔2的幂次个时钟周期输出一次状态值来实现,这样不会影响m序列的周期,同时减少了相邻样点的相关性。这种方法不需要额外的硬件资源,如交织器,从而节省了FPGA的资源。 接着,从均匀分布转化为高斯分布,通常采用Box-Muller变换或者Ziggurat算法。文中提到的是通过均匀分布和高斯分布之间的映射关系进行转换。具体方法未在给出的部分中详细阐述,但通常涉及到将均匀分布的随机数映射到具有特定均值和方差的高斯分布。 通过FPGA实现的高斯白噪声生成方案,结合有效的均匀分布到高斯分布转换方法,可以在实验室环境中快速模拟短波通信信道的噪声特性,对通信设备的性能进行精确评估。这样的设计有助于提高研发效率,降低测试成本,并为通信系统的设计和优化提供有力支持。
2026-01-06 16:15:05
292KB
EDA/PLD
1
Deform-Prototype:用于在编辑器中以及在Unity中运行时使网格变形的原型框架。 不再在开发中,但是它仍然很棒!
小心! 我已经从头开始编写了! 客观上来说更好,您应该完全检查一下! 这是一个小预告片。 变形 变形是一个框架,用于在编辑器中以及在运行时变形网格,该框架附带一个基于组件的变形系统。 如果您不想制作自己的变形器,则可以在3D建模包中找到许多标准变形器。 重要 如果在现有项目中使用此功能,则需要转到“编辑/项目设置/播放器/”并将“脚本运行时版本”(在“其他设置”下拉列表下)设置为4.6。 目前,该项目不适合专业发展。 除非您对功能集感到满意,否则请不要在大型项目中使用它。 如果您不使用版本控制,请勿在不备份项目的情况下更新到该系统的新版本。 您制作的资料会在99%的时间内中断,因为几
2026-01-06 13:42:30
7.74MB
csharp
unity
tool
unity3d
1
libELM:Arduino库可处理与用于车载诊断的ELM327或ELM327兼容芯片的通信
ELM库 贡献者: , , 机构:斯图加特传媒大学许可证: GPLv3( ) ELM库是一个Arduino库,可处理与用于汽车车载诊断的或ELM327兼容芯片的通信。 它支持显示当前数据(OBD模式1)以及显示和清除诊断故障代码(DTC)。 此外,它能够显示车辆信息,例如和ECU模型。 注意:该库实际上是为开发的。 入门 设置ELM库非常容易。 注意:该库使用SoftwareSerial连接到ELM芯片。 并非在所有Arduino引脚上都提供SoftwareSerial! 有关更多信息,请参见。 # include < elm> byte serialRX = 9 ; // RX pin byte serialTX = 10 ; // TX pin ELM myELM (serialRX, serialTX); void setup () { // initia
2026-01-06 00:33:26
12KB
1
fpga图像处理-isp测试用raw图像
fpga图像处理-isp测试用raw图像
2026-01-05 19:46:24
5.35MB
fpga图像处理
1
机械臂视觉抓取仿真:vrep与matlab联合仿真示例(学习用) 机器视觉 v1.0
内容概要:本文详细介绍了利用VREP与MATLAB进行机械臂视觉抓取仿真的具体步骤和技术要点。首先,通过GUI界面在MATLAB端控制机械臂抓取不同物体,并展示了基本但简陋的图像处理算法用于识别目标物的颜色区域。接着,重点讲解了从相机坐标系到机械臂坐标系的转换方法,强调了坐标系转换过程中可能遇到的问题如轴序错误等。此外,还提到了一些常见的调试技巧以及潜在的改进方向,比如将MATLAB替换为Python并引入ROS系统以适应工业级应用的需求。 适合人群:具有一定编程基础并对机器人视觉抓取感兴趣的科研工作者或学生。 使用场景及目标:①掌握VREP与MATLAB之间的通信配置;②理解图像处理的基本流程及其局限性;③学会正确地进行坐标系间的转换计算;④熟悉常见故障排查手段。 其他说明:文中提供的代码片段较为初级,鼓励读者在此基础上进一步优化和完善。同时提醒初学者注意相关基础知识的学习,避免因基础不足导致难以理解或操作失败。
2026-01-05 18:26:26
1.31MB
1
ggml-tiny.bin 是 Whisper 语音识别模型的一个轻量级版本 ,用于语音识别
ggml-tiny.bin 是 Whisper 语音识别模型的一个轻量级版本,基于 GGML 格式(一种为 CPU 优化的量化模型格式)。以下是详细说明: 1. 模型背景 Whisper 是 OpenAI 开源的自动语音识别(ASR)系统,支持多语言转录和翻译。 GGML 是一个专注于 CPU 推理的 tensor 库,支持量化(如 4-bit、5-bit 等),显著减少模型体积和内存占用。 2. ggml-tiny.bin 特点 轻量化:tiny 是 Whisper 的最小版本,参数量少(约 39M),适合低算力设备(如树莓派、手机等)。 量化版本:.bin 文件通常是 GGML 格式的量化模型,可能为 4-bit 或 5-bit,牺牲少量精度以提升推理速度。 功能:支持基础语音转录,但准确率低于大模型(如 base、small)。 3. 使用场景 嵌入式设备或移动端离线语音识别。 快速原型开发或对延迟敏感的应用。 4. 如何使用 依赖工具:需搭配 whisper.cpp 或类似支持 GGML 的推理库。 示例命令(假设已安装 whisper.cpp): ./main -m models/ggml-tiny.bin -f input.wav 5. 局限性 准确率较低,尤其对复杂口音或背景噪声敏感。 仅支持转录,无翻译功能(除非额外微调)。 如需更高精度,可考虑 ggml-base.bin 或 ggml-small.bin。模型文件通常从开源社区(如 Hugging Face)获取。 怎样使用可以参考:https://blog.csdn.net/qq_33906319/article/details/147320987?sharetype=blogdetail&sharerId=147320987&sharerefer=PC&sharesource=qq_3390631
2026-01-05 14:42:12
74.09MB
Whisper
1
一种用于MEMS陀螺的高精度电容读出电路的设计* (2010年)
针对电容式MEMS陀螺,设计了一种高精度CMOS接口读出电路。从理论上分析了接口寄生电容、器件的不匹配对接口电路的影响,采用连续时间电压读出方式的检测方法,设计了一款带有输入输出共模反馈的低噪声全差分电荷运算放大器,输入输出共模电压稳定在2.5 V,输人端的噪声电压为9 nV。载波调制技术用来消除低频闪烁噪声。在Cadence中对设计的接口电路进行仿真分析,并采用PCB电路板进行了实验。结果显示所提出的接口电路不仅消除了大部分寄生电容的影响,抑制了大部分的耦合信号和噪声信号,而且减小了由于器件的不匹配产生
2026-01-05 13:46:07
291KB
工程技术
论文
1
FCSalyzer:FCSalyzer 是一款用于分析流式细胞术数据的免费程序-开源
FCSalyzer 是一个用于分析流式细胞术数据的免费程序。 它是用 Java 编程的,因此应该可以在许多不同的操作系统上运行。 FCSalyzer 提供简单的所见即所得界面,并提供标准分析工具 - 点图、直方图、复杂的门控策略和相关统计。 印象/法律声明 Sven Mostböck Murlingengasse 25/5 1120 Wien Austria 电子邮件:sven_mostboeck@users.sourceforge.net 第二个联系方式:使用 FCSalyzer sourceforge 页面上的公开讨论:http://sourceforge.net/p/fcsalyzer/讨论/
2026-01-05 13:26:18
985KB
开源软件
1
8种加密狗侦听工具,查密码很好用
监听常用的8中加密狗,查密码很好用, rockey4nd,rockey6,sense3,sense4,域天简单型,softdog,,,,,,
2026-01-05 10:39:50
3.92MB
1
用图论思想求解以下各题-图论讲义PPT
用图论思想求解以下各题 例1、一摆渡人欲将一只狼,一头羊,一篮菜从 河西渡过河到河东,由于船小,一次只能带一物 过河,并且,狼与羊,羊与菜不能独处,给出渡 河方法。 图论的基本概念
2026-01-05 08:52:00
1.83MB
1
个人信息
点我去登录
购买积分
下载历史
恢复订单
热门下载
非线性本构关系在ABAQUS中的实现.pdf
elsevier 爱思唯尔 系列期刊的word模板,template,单栏,双栏
IEEE33节点配电网Simulink模型.rar
基于STM32的电子时钟设计
大唐杯资料+题库(移动通信)
python大作业--爬虫(完美应付大作业).zip
校园网规划与设计(报告和pkt文件)
2019和2021年华为单板通用硬件笔试题及答案
多目标微粒子群算法MOPSO MATLAB代码
EasyMedia-ui.zip
西安问题电缆-工程伦理案例分析.zip
PowerBI视觉对象共计271组,更新日期2021.01.20日.zip
基于YOLOV5的车牌定位和识别源码.zip
基于Matlab的IEEE14节点潮流计算.zip
多机器人编队及避障仿真算法.zip
最新下载
C2000Ware_4_01_00_00
精雕5.50的帮助文件
英雄王座onlineb.zip
phpMyAdmin批量破解工具.rar
御剑1.5 想念初恋
黑帽常用:劫持百度蜘蛛(关键词劫持)跳转js演示
BBasic2.0虚拟机及编程平台
昌斯特hd-wifi工业内窥镜app
将Dell T30刷成3620
wmsxwd (2).exe
其他资源
16进制转jpg图片小工具(FMC实现)
汇编中的10H中断int 10h详细说明.doc
基于STM32的智能家居控制系统的设计与实现.docx
CMMI-dev-V1.3简体中文版最终发布版本
python 滑雪小游戏
3dmax实用高效插件
DNS解析,gethostbyname的C源码
java 实习 总结
Xilinx FPGA最小系统原理图(XC3S400+USB2实用)
web课程设计——jsp投票系统
矩阵论(第三版)程云鹏pdf电子书
Python-图像分类目标检测姿态估计分割的Pytorch实现
StarSpace:学习嵌入以进行分类,检索和排名-源码
第三方串口类
离散数学重点难点.docx
点文件-源码
easyclick实例下载(联众打码).zip
全国2018年4月自考04741《计算机网络原理》试题及答案解析
分享一套HTML5实现PPT效果的源码
大数据开发指南(实际项目)
《向咨询行业学图表》Excel 2013 数据源资料__by 一图
软件评测师考试考点分析与真题详解2
酒店管理系统
Visual Basic Upgrade Companion(VBUC) lic
论文免费查重(paperpass、维普等)(助论文修改),亲测可用